1979 280ZX. 210,000 miles After a complete engine rebuild the car runs like a clock. BUT, the idle speed starts at 8oo RPM and creeps up to 1700 RPM after warm up. The idle screw doesn't seem to have any control. I found a used throttle body on line but I am not sure that is the culprit. Anyone have any ideas on how to get the idle speed under control? I hate to be sitting at a traffic light with the engine idleing that fast. |
